Iron and Wine | Radio City Music Hall
Sam Beam breathily sang his way into hipster hearts with lo-fi acoustic ballads—most prominently among them (thanks to “Garden State” and M&M commercials), a stripped-down cover of the Postal Service’s “Such Great Heights.” Since then, he’s shown increasing interest in being more of a band leader than a one-man show. Perhaps it was inevitable, then, that he’d jump to the major labels to make self-described “early-to-mid-‘70s FM, radio-friendly music” with help from a member of an acclaimed Afrobeat band (Antibalas’ Stuart Bogie guests).
